Found the solution for anyone else who needs this info: First, when we create the user account we can suppress the email using the following code:https://th3silverlining.com/2011/10/30/salesforce-stop-email-being-sent-on-user-creation-or-password-reset-or/ (https://th3silverlining.com/2011/10/30/salesforce-stop-email-being-sent-on-user-creation-or-password-reset-or/" target="_blank) Second, if we set up Federated Authentication with the portal as the identity provider we can log the user in with SAML SSO. https://developer.salesforce.com/page/Single_Sign-On_with_SAML_on_Force.com (https://developer.salesforce.com/page/Single_Sign-On_with_SAML_on_Force.com" target="_blank)
